What Is a UV Shoe Sanitizer and How Does It Work for Disinfection?

A UV shoe sanitizer is a device that uses ultraviolet (UV) light to eliminate bacteria, viruses, and fungi from shoes. This technology disinfects footwear efficiently by targeting microorganisms present on surfaces.

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) recognizes UV light’s efficacy in killing germs, stating that exposure to UV-C light (a specific wavelength) can deactivate pathogens effectively.

UV shoe sanitizers operate by emitting UV-C light, which penetrates the cell walls of microbes. This exposure damages their DNA or RNA, rendering them unable to reproduce or cause infection. The devices are typically compact and designed for easy use.

According to the World Health Organization (WHO), disinfecting surfaces can greatly reduce the transmission of infectious diseases. This encompasses shoes, which often carry pathogens due to contact with contaminated surfaces.

Factors contributing to the need for shoe sanitation include increased foot traffic in public areas, rising concerns about hygiene, and the prevalence of antibiotic-resistant bacteria.

A 2021 study by the American Journal of Infection Control reported that shoe soles can carry up to 421,000 colony-forming units of bacteria, highlighting the importance of disinfection methods like UV sanitizers.

The use of UV shoe sanitizers can significantly reduce the risk of spreading infections. This promotes overall public health and increases awareness of hygiene practices, especially in healthcare settings.

On health, society, and the economy, UV sanitizers represent a move towards better hygiene standards. Proper use can minimize healthcare costs associated with infection control, improving quality of life.

For instance, healthcare workers and patients can benefit from consistently disinfected footwear, reducing cross-contamination in clinical environments.

Experts recommend integrating UV shoe sanitizers in environments with high foot traffic. The CDC advocates using these devices in hospitals, schools, and public transport to enhance hygiene practices.

Technologies such as automatic UV disinfection systems, along with regular cleaning practices, can help mitigate the risks associated with germs on footwear. Ensuring adherence to recommended usage guidelines maximizes sanitation effectiveness.

How Do UV Rays Effectively Kill Germs and Bacteria in Shoes?

UV rays effectively kill germs and bacteria in shoes by damaging their DNA and disrupting cellular functions, leading to their inactivation. This process can be summarized through several key mechanisms:

  • DNA Damage: UV-C light, specifically between 200 to 280 nanometers, penetrates the cell wall of bacteria and viruses. It causes thymine dimers to form in their DNA, preventing replication and transcription, as explained by a study in the Journal of Photochemistry and Photobiology (Pogorzelska-Nowicka et al., 2017).

  • Disruption of Cellular Functions: UV light affects essential cellular processes. It inhibits metabolic pathways, reducing the bacteria’s ability to grow, replicate, and perform vital functions.

  • Reduced Viability: A study conducted by Griffiths et al. (2012) found that exposure to UV-C light reduced the viability of bacteria, showing a significant decrease in colony-forming units. The effectiveness increases with exposure time and intensity.

  • Broad Spectrum Effects: UV rays are effective against a wide range of pathogens, including bacteria, fungi, and viruses. Research published in the American Journal of Infection Control (Venkatesh et al., 2017) indicates UV systems can reduce microbial counts on various surfaces.

  • Safety and Ease of Use: UV shoe sanitizers are user-friendly. They often operate with simple mechanisms, merely requiring the shoes to be placed in the sanitizing chamber. The process is chemical-free, ensuring no harmful residues are left after treatment.

These mechanisms demonstrate how UV rays can provide effective disinfection for shoes, contributing to better foot hygiene and overall health.

Can a UV Shoe Sanitizer Help Eliminate Odors and Bacteria?

Yes, a UV shoe sanitizer can help eliminate odors and bacteria.

Ultraviolet (UV) light effectively destroys microorganisms, including bacteria and fungi, that cause unpleasant smells. The UV light disrupts the DNA of these pathogens, rendering them inactive and unable to reproduce. By using a UV shoe sanitizer, users can target hard-to-reach areas inside shoes where bacteria thrive due to moisture and warmth. This process can significantly reduce odor levels and improve overall shoe hygiene. Regular use can lead to healthier feet and a fresher environment.

How Do You Choose the Best UV Shoe Sanitizer for Your Needs?

To choose the best UV shoe sanitizer for your needs, consider factors like UV light effectiveness, safety features, size and design, sanitization time, and price.

  • UV light effectiveness: Look for sanitizers that use UVC light, which effectively kills bacteria and viruses. A study by the American Journal of Infection Control (Miller et al., 2018) highlights that UVC radiation can eliminate up to 99.9% of pathogens in a short period.

  • Safety features: Choose a sanitizer that includes safety mechanisms, such as automatic shut-off systems. This feature prevents UV exposure when the device is open. Safety is crucial to avoid harm from UV radiation.

  • Size and design: The size of the sanitizer should accommodate your footwear. Some models fit various shoe types, such as sneakers and boots. A compact design may be more portable, allowing for easy use while traveling.

  • Sanitization time: Different products have varying sanitization times. Most effective UV shoe sanitizers require 10 to 30 minutes for a complete cycle. Research shows that longer exposure times may enhance germicidal effectiveness, but ensure that the time matches your lifestyle needs.

  • Price: UV shoe sanitizers are available in various price ranges. Set a budget and compare features across products to find one that offers the best value for your specific requirements.

By evaluating these factors, you can find a UV shoe sanitizer that effectively meets your hygiene needs and fits your lifestyle.

Are There Size and Weight Considerations for Travel-Friendly UV Shoe Sanitizers?

Yes, there are size and weight considerations for travel-friendly UV shoe sanitizers. Many portable models are designed to be lightweight and compact, making them convenient for travelers without adding significant bulk or weight to luggage.

Travel-friendly UV shoe sanitizers typically have similarities and differences. Compact devices often fit into most shoe sizes and can be charged via USB ports. For example, some models measure around 7 inches in length and weigh approximately 1 pound. In contrast, larger, stationary sanitizers may take up more space and are more suitable for home use. Travelers should consider the specific dimensions and weight of each model to ensure it meets their portability needs.

The positive aspects of travel-friendly UV shoe sanitizers include their effectiveness in eliminating harmful bacteria and viruses. Research indicates that UV light can kill up to 99.9% of pathogens in a matter of minutes. According to a study published in the Journal of Applied Microbiology (2018), UV light sanitization is a highly effective method for disinfection, particularly in personal items like shoes that are often overlooked in hygiene routines.

On the negative side, some travel-friendly shoe sanitizers may have limitations in sanitization effectiveness. They may not reach all areas of a shoe, particularly if the interior is heavily soiled or if the design restricts UV light exposure. An article in Healthline (2021) notes that while UV devices are effective, uneven distribution of light may lead to incomplete disinfection. Users should clean shoes before sanitizing for optimal results.

When considering a travel-friendly UV shoe sanitizer, select a model that balances size, weight, and effectiveness. Opt for a compact unit if traveling frequently, but ensure it has adequate UV-C exposure and safety features, such as auto shut-off. If you regularly wear larger shoes, verify that the sanitizer accommodates your shoe size. Budget for a reputable brand that meets safety standards for UV use, prioritizing devices with positive customer reviews.

How Does a UV Shoe Sanitizer Compare to Other Shoe Disinfection Methods?

UV shoe sanitizers utilize ultraviolet light to disinfect shoes, killing bacteria, viruses, and fungi. Below is a comparison of UV shoe sanitizers against other common shoe disinfection methods:

MethodEffectivenessTime RequiredEase of UseCostSafety
UV Shoe SanitizerHighly effective against pathogensTypically 10-30 minutesVery easy, just place shoes insideModerate to highSafe for shoes, but UV light can be harmful if exposed
Alcohol SprayEffective, but may not kill all pathogensImmediateEasy, but requires manual sprayingLowFlammable and may irritate skin
Disinfectant WipesEffective for surface pathogensImmediateEasy, but requires manual cleaningLowMay contain chemicals that irritate skin
Hot Air DryingReduces moisture, some bacterial reduction30-60 minutesModerate, requires specific equipmentLowGenerally safe, but may damage certain shoe materials

Each method has its pros and cons, and the choice may depend on personal preference and specific needs for shoe disinfection.
